OpenAI Launches Free Customizable AI Models, Challenging Meta's Approach

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

OpenAI has announced the release of two open-weight large language models, gpt-oss-120b and gpt-oss-20b-two, which are freely available for download and customization. This move marks a significant shift from OpenAI's previous closed model approach with ChatGPT. The models are designed to be accessible to a wide audience, promoting democratic values and broad benefits. OpenAI's CEO, Sam Altman, emphasized the importance of making AI accessible to as many people as possible. This initiative is seen as a direct challenge to Meta's Llama models, which are also available for customization but have faced criticism for not being fully open source. The release has sparked concerns among experts about the potential misuse of these powerful AI models, including the development of bioweapons.
